These are the four bags I hit regularly: (Measurements are mine, not mfg, and not including the height of the loop)
1. Jim Bradley 12" by 9"
2. Everlast 4200 8" by 7"
3. Jim Bradley 9" by 6.5"
4. Lonsdale Peanut 8.5" by 5.5"
The big Jim Bradley is a cannon. Like hitting a watermelon. Fun sometimes but I don't use it much anymore. The fat little Everlast is nice to hit. It's soft but kind of wobbly and it doesn't always have a consistent rebound. The red Jim Bradley was my favorite until I got the Peanut. The leather and craftsmanship on it is beautiful and it's soft on the hands. But it always felt kind of light to me. Now I'm into the Peanut. It was tricky for the first few minutes but now I love the speed of it. Always nice consistent rebounds, and goes as fast as I can hit it. I thought the narrowness might be a problem but now I like it better than the more pear-shaped bags. I've never tried to hit a smaller bag, but now I might go for one. Any suggestions?
